Here’s a comprehensive look at the upcoming schedule:

  • Selection Sunday takes place at 6 p.m. ET on March 16, broadcasted on CBS.
  • First Four: March 18-19
  • First Round: March 20-21
  • Second Round: March 22-23
  • Sweet 16: March 27-28
  • Elite Eight: March 29-30
  • The Final Four is set for April 5 at the Alamodome in San Antonio, Texas.
  • The NCAA Championship showdown will occur on April 7, also at the Alamodome.

Explore the venues hosting the men’s tournament in 2025:

ROUND CITY VENUE DATES HOST
First Four Dayton, Ohio UD Arena March 18-19 University of Dayton
First/Second Lexington, KY Rupp Arena March 20-22 University of Kentucky
First/Second Providence, RI Amica Mutual Pavilion March 20-22 Providence College
First/Second Seattle, WA Climate Pledge Arena March 21-23 University of Washington
First/Second Wichita, KS Intrust Bank Arena March 20-22 Wichita State University
First/Second Cleveland, OH Rocket Arena March 21-23 Mid-American Conference
First/Second Denver, CO Ball Arena March 20-22 Mountain West Conference
First/Second Milwaukee, WI Fiserv Forum March 21-23 Marquette University
First/Second Raleigh, NC Lenovo Center March 21-23 NC State University
East Regional Newark, NJ Prudential Center March 27-29 Seton Hall University
West Regional San Francisco, CA Chase Center March 27-29 Pac-12 Conference
South Regional Atlanta, GA State Farm Arena March 28-30 Georgia Institute of Technology
Midwest Regional Indianapolis, IN Lucas Oil Stadium March 28-30 IU Indianapolis/Horizon League
